The Viennale is taking its major anniversary – celebrating 50 years of the festival

The Viennale is taking its major anniversary – celebrating 50 years of the festival – as an opportunity to present a large number of special projects and activities. They will start in spring 2012 and will last until the end of the year. In addition, a series of international festivals and institutions will pay tribute to the Viennale’s anniversary with special programs.
As early as in April a

nd May, three important, international film festivals are paying homage to the Viennale with programs consisting of selected films from the Vienna festival’s 50-year history; works that represent the Viennale’s development and spirit in a special way.
The first to present a program in honor of the Viennale is the Buenos Aires International Film Festival (BAFICI), which started on April 11. Following suit are the Korean film festival of Jeonju, which takes place from April 26 to May 4, and the renowned Portuguese IndieLisboa at the end of April/beginning of May. Varying from festival to festival, the different programs include films by directors such as Vera Chytilová, Terayama Shuji, Wes Anderson, Nina Menkes, Ousmane Sembène, Luc Moullet, Rithy Panh, Valeska Grisebach, Ross McElwee and Agnès Varda.


In the following months, similar tributes are planned by festivals and institutions in Marseille, Munich and New York. “The Viennale is honored and proud about the great international acknowledgement expressed in such a multifaceted manner on the occasion of the festival’s anniversary,” says Viennale director Hans Hurch.
